as a hot air balloon rises vertically, its angle of elevation from point P on level ground 110 kilometers from th epoint Q directly underneath the balloon changes from 15 degree 5' to 31 degree 45'.
Approximately how far does the balloon rise during this period?
a. 38.4 km
b. 97.7 km
c.106.5 km
d. 86.5 km
e. 199.7 km
i need help solving this

Answers

Answered by Steve
If the balloon rises from height h to height H,

h/110 = tan(15°5')
H/110 = tan(31°45')

Distance risen = H-h
